The Role of Group Chats in Political Discourse
Group chats and social media platforms have transformed the way political conversations are held, particularly among right-wing supporters. These digital spaces often serve as echo chambers that amplify certain ideologies while silencing dissenting opinions. In many discussions, any critical voice is quickly labeled as suffering from “Trump Derangement Syndrome” (TDS), a term that has gained traction particularly among supporters of Donald Trump. This labeling method not only factions conversations but also creates a barrier to constructive dialogue, further entrenching polarizing views.
The inclusion and, conversely, exclusion of perspectives within these group discussions reflect a broader trend in how media shapes political ideologies. As groups form around specific political beliefs, the narratives promoted within these circles often prioritize loyalty over healthy debate. This phenomenon raises questions about the future of political discourse and the ability to bridge divides in an ever-polarized environment.
Global Right’s Relationship with Trump Ahead of 2024
Another essential angle in this discussion is the global Right’s fluctuating dynamics regarding their support for Donald Trump as the 2024 election approaches. Various articles, including those from platforms like UnHerd, have critically examined shifts in loyalty among right-wing factions worldwide. While Trump’s influence remains potent, there are indications that some factions are grappling with the implications of backing his candidacy given the ongoing controversies and political strategies at play.
The upcoming election cycle is not just a referendum on Trump himself but serves as a litmus test for the strategies employed by his supporters and campaign team. Observers note that the manner in which Trump’s base rallies around or retracts their support could significantly alter the political landscape not only in the United States but also internationally.
